Okoto and Sasuke

June 15, 1935 1h 40m 6.7/10 (3 votes)

Originally released in 1935. Okoto and Sasuke is a drama film. directed by Yasujirō Shimazu.

Starring Kinuyo Tanaka, Kōkichi Takada, and Hideo Fujino

Synopsis

A period piece about the love of a wealthy blind woman, a teacher of koto and shamisen, and her devoted manservant. Based on a novella by Tanizaki Junichiro.
